ATTEMPTED ESCAFE FROM INVERCARGILL REFORMATORY
(srECIAI. TO "TUB TRESS"). INVERCARGILL, November 27. Two prisoners at tho . lnvercargill -. reformatory prison attempted to escape on Tuesday afternoon. They were working in a concrete shod, and walked out when the warder, was engaged supervising tho loading of a truck. Th«y were seen by another warder who was posted on an elevated bridge. Ho called on them to stop or. he would fire. Ono prisoner threw up his hands , and stopped, and the other ran. Tho warder'fired, and the prisoner threw himself down in a ditch, and gave up the attempt. They will bo ' charged, with attempting to escape from custody.
